Is instantiating a template necessary in tosca?

Last Update: April 20, 2022

This is a question our experts keep getting from time to time. Now, we have got the complete detailed explanation and answer for everyone, who is interested!

Asked by: Trisha Yost Jr.
Score: 4.6/5 (38 votes)

A TestSheet should only be used for one TestCase Template. While Tosca allows you to link a TestSheet to more than one Template, it should be avoided as it is harder to maintain and keep an overview of several Templates.

Is it necessary to instantiate a template?

In order for any code to appear, a template must be instantiated: the template arguments must be provided so that the compiler can generate an actual class (or function, from a function template).

Is it necessary to instantiate a template in Tosca?

As a result, Tosca creates a TestCase in the TemplateInstance for each TestCase defined in the template. The TestCase structure matches the structure of the corresponding TestCase in the template. The TestCase to be instantiated must be marked as a template (see chapter "Working with TestCase templates").

How do I instantiate a template in Tosca?

Instantiate those TestCases by clicking the Instantiate button in the dynamic menu TestCases. Navigate to the import folder of the Tosca Data Integrity Modules And Samples. tsu subset. Copy the TestCase Load file into DB located under _Tosca DI Templates->TestCase Templates->Pre-Screening.

What is the use of templates in Tosca?

Templates are models for concrete TestCases. TestCases with a similar sequence can be generalized with a template and be dynamically created using an external DataSource. This process is called dynamic TestCase generation.

TRICENTIS Tosca - Lesson 17 | Create Template | Link TestSheet to Template | Instantiate Template

38 related questions found

What are Web services in Tosca?

Tosca Webservice Engine 3.0 allows Webservices to be steered via Hypertext Transfer Protocol (HTTP). Webservices using SOAP (Simple Object Acces Protocol) or REST Webservices (Representational State Transfer) can be steered.

How do you convert test cases to templates in Tosca?

To convert the TestCase to a Template, make a right-click on the TestCase and select Convert to Template from the context menu. Alternatively, you can click on the TestCase and select Convert to Template from the dynamic menu TestCases.

Can we run template in the ScratchBook?

However, unlike with ExecutionLists, Tosca Commander does not save the structure you create in the ScratchBook, nor does it store the results. If you want to run tests in the ScratchBook, the following options are available: You can add and arrange objects in the ScratchBook and then run them.

How many Testsheets can be linked to a template at a time?

While Tosca allows you to link a TestSheet to more than one Template, it should be avoided as it is harder to maintain and keep an overview of several Templates. Each TestSheet should be used for one template only. If the same data is required for multiple Templates, we recommend using Classes.

Can we run a template in the ScratchBook one correct answer?

Ans: Yes, we can create a TestCase template manually by using the Tosca BI modules. To create a template, right-click on the test case and select the “Convert to Template” option in the context menu.

Which button opens TestSheet linked to your template?

The linked TestSheet can also be reached by right-clicking on the Template and selecting Jump to Schema Definition from the menu, the shortcut for this is CTRL+J.

What is the correct process to link a TestSheet to a template?

To create automated TestCases from a TestSheet or TestCase-Design Class, follow the steps below: Create a TestCase Template in the TestCases section of Tricentis Tosca. Drag and drop your TestSheet or Class onto the TestCase Template.

Can Int be used to instantiate templates?

template MyStack<int, 6>::MyStack( void ); You can explicitly instantiate function templates by using a specific type argument to re-declare them, as shown in the example in Function Template Instantiation. ... Functions defined inside the class declaration are considered inline functions and are always instantiated.

How do I instantiate a template?

To instantiate a template class explicitly, follow the template keyword by a declaration (not definition) for the class, with the class identifier followed by the template arguments. template class Array<char>; template class String<19>; When you explicitly instantiate a class, all of its members are also instantiated.

How do I instantiate a template function?

To instantiate a template function explicitly, follow the template keyword by a declaration (not definition) for the function, with the function identifier followed by the template arguments. template float twice<float>(float original); Template arguments may be omitted when the compiler can infer them.

What subsections are available in an if statement?

Condition (within the IF statement) THEN (within the IF statement) ELSE (optional)

What are the correct steps to use identify by parent?

How to Identify by Parent
  1. Select the control to identify in XScan.
  2. Locate and select its parent control.
  3. Ensure that the parent control is uniquely identifiable.
  4. Save.

How do you create a TestSheet?

To create a TestSheet follow the steps below:
  1. Right-click on the folder in which you want to create a TestSheet.
  2. Select Create TestSheet from the mini toolbar.
  3. Re-name your TestSheet as desired.

How do you run a TestCase in Tosca?

In Tosca Commander, right-click the Enter Product Data TestStep and select Run in ScratchBook from the context menu. Alternatively, you can select the Enter Product Data TestStep and press F6, or you can click on Run in ScratchBook in the TestCases menu.

What is control group in Tosca?

Link, button and radio button controls can be grouped in Tosca (see chapter "Options for Modules and ModuleAttributes").

Can we run template in ScratchBook Tosca?

The ScratchBook in Tosca Commander is used for running individual TestSteps upon TestCase creation. ... You can also left-click on the TestStep and select Run in ScratchBook from the dynamic menu TestCases. Running the TestStep in Scratchbook. The ScratchBook window opens and Tosca runs the Vehicle data TestStep.

What is Tosca template?

The TOSCA language describes cloud services using "templates" and "plans." Templates define the structure of a cloud service. ... For example, TOSCA could be used to describe the relationship between Docker containers, virtual machines, server components, endpoints and services within a cloud environment.

Can API testing fully replace UI testing with Tosca?

Benefits API Testing in TOSCA:

Hence testing can be initiated much before actual functional testing (UI based) is done. Frequent application changes can be tested quickly. It is easy to maintain test cases in TOSCA. The API testing in TOSCA can be done much faster.

What is requirement in Tosca?

The testing lifecycle begins by identifying the criteria which the system under test is expected to fulfill. In Tricentis Tosca, these are called Requirements. ... Requirements can be either: Functional criteria, or functionalities the system under test must be able to carry out.